WebJun 20, 2010 · If you have an electrical receptacle in an outlet that is making buzzing noises or is sparking, you should correct the problem immediately in order to prevent the possibility of an electrical fire. Although correcting these type of problems in receptacles is a rather easy process, it is one that should not be delayed. WebSep 14, 2024 · Electromagnetic interference can be caused by power lines, fluorescent lights, and electrical outlets. If any of these types of things are near your amplifier or guitar, it can cause a humming noise in your signal.
